Not mine, but very different.
tmas




It started as a 1973 Z50. I got a set of MR50 forks off ebay for $45 and made my own triple clamps, bar risers, kick stand and brake pedal, all out of billet. The emblem on the tank is from a 1970-71 Z50. The rims are 10 inch and the swing arm is extended 4 inches. I am still waiting for a Kitaco 4 inch over swingarm from classic honda but they are very slow. The motor, which I built myself has a Trailbikes 88cc Big bore/race head and manual clutch and the original 1973 bottom end, high volume oil pump ect. the exhaust and tail section are also from classic honda as well as the shift pedal.
